... Read moreMaking Oreo balls at home is one of the simplest yet most satisfying ways to enjoy a rich dessert without turning on the oven. The process starts with crushing 36 original Oreos into fine crumbs, which gives the base a perfect texture. Mixing in 8 ounces of softened cream cheese binds the crumbs together, creating a creamy mixture that's easy to roll. I’ve found that chilling the rolled balls in the freezer for about 20 minutes before dipping them into melted chocolate helps them hold their shape better and achieves a cleaner coating. While white chocolate is a popular choice for dipping, you can experiment with milk or dark chocolate based on your preference. For an extra touch, topping the dipped balls with crushed Oreos not only looks elegant but adds a delightful crunch. These bites are perfect for sharing at gatherings or as an indulgent personal treat. From personal experience, using quality cream cheese and freshly crushed Oreos makes a big difference in flavor and texture. Also, melting the chocolate gently using a double boiler prevents it from burning and keeps it smooth for dipping.
